Cover Story: Webb legacy spans 75 years

The Black family lived in South Park, now Merriam. It was an integrated community founded in 1887. Sixty years later, Alfonso and Mary Webb fought against a plan to segregate Black and white pupils between new and old schools. The buildings were unequal in quality.
